Transaction 531a1f76d95ec0eaeb014ef2efd4ac8ea8821ed17e591c8a13e54726fe671a1d

1 Input
2 Outputs
  • 531a1f76d95ec0eaeb014ef2efd4ac8ea8821ed17e591c8a13e54726fe671a1d:0
  • value  567071833
    address  158x3Ea6esxdQNRRj52WrpFuJyLU3QvgtN
  • 531a1f76d95ec0eaeb014ef2efd4ac8ea8821ed17e591c8a13e54726fe671a1d:1
  • value  446889975
    address  3J6K6vxPoHdBcy5TsT9qpTEF64niR4VZmR